Describe the traders’ community of medieval period.

A.VERIFIED ANSWERfact-checked by tutors

Ans. The middle classes in medieval India consisted mainly of merchants, proficient classes and officials. There was high class professionalism among Indian merchants. They were experts in wholesale and retail trade. The whole sale traders were called Seth or Vorah and the retailers were Beoparies or Baniks. In south India, the Chettis formed the trading community. There was a special class called Banjaras who used to be in motion from place to place loaded with food grains, salt, ghee etc.
